DESCRIPTION (provided by applicant): The graft-versus-host-disease (GVHD) which
complicates allogeneic bone marrow transplantation is characterized by organ
damage including dermatitis, enteritis, and hepatitis. A majority of
post-transplant patients also develop antibodies to self-antigens, including
anti-dsDNA, which mimic those in systemic lupus erythematosus. The development
of both manifestations requires CD4+ T cells; however, the specificity of the
inciting T cells is largely unknown. We propose to utilize transgenic models to
examine the CD4 cell-antigen presenting cell (APC) interactions which initiate
murine GVHD. K14 mice are a model of abnormal thymic development in which CD4+
T cells are autoreactive due to a failure of negative selection.
H2-DM-deficient thymi select autoreactive CD4+ cells on restricted class
II-associated peptides. K14 CD4 cells induce anti-dsDNA antibodies in syngeneic
hosts; H2-DM-deficient CD4+ do not. 2-2-3 mice carry transgenes for the TCR
genes from a B6-reactive K14 T cell hybridoma, 2-2-3. Double transgenic
2-2-3/K14 mice spontaneously develop skin disease which histologically
resembles cutaneous GVHI); however, 2-2-31K14 CD4+ cells cannot induce
autoantibodies in syngeneic mice. Thus, cutaneous GVHD is induced by monoclonal
T cells which interact with keratinocytes; whereas, the production of
autoantibodies during GVHD requires the activation of a diverse repertoire of T
cells. In Specific Aim I, we will ask why K14, H2-DM, and 2-2-3/K14 CD4 cells
induce different spectrums of autoantibodies after transfer to syngeneic hosts.
We will examine the localization, division, and cytokine production of
transferred CD4+ cells and B cell activation and germinal center production.
Specific Aim II will extend these studies to investigate anti-DNA Ab production
during GVHD in a mouse transgenic for the heavy chain of an anti-DNA antibody.
In Specific Aim III, the keratinocyte/CD4+ cell interactions required for
cutaneous GVHD in 2-2-3/K14 mice will be dissected. Temporal requirement for
hematopoietic APC, inflammatory cytokines, and MHC class II expression in skin
will be determined. Finally, in Specific Aim IV, we will identify the peptide
specificity of the autoreactive 2-2-3 CD4 cell response to APC and
keratinocytes in GVHD. Understanding the requirements for T cell diversity and
the interactions between "graft" T cells and host antigen presenting cells
offers improved immunologic targets for preventing GVHD following bone marrow
transplant.
